Placenta accreta spectrum is a prevalent cause of severe postpartum hemorrhage and emergency hysterectomy. In recent years, there has been an increasing incidence of placenta accreta spectrum. Besides traumatic uterine injury factors such as elevated cesarean section rates, other non-traumatic factors including uterine malformation, endometritis, uterine adenomyosis, in vitro fertilization-embryo transfer also warrant serious consideration. This article focuses on early disease detection, standardized diagnosis, prevention, and treatment of placental implantation disorders associated with non-traumatic factors to enhance the adverse outcomes for these parturients.
